sys.service_broker_endpoints (Transact-SQL)

Область применения: SQL Server

Это представление каталога содержит по одной строке на каждую конечную точку компонента Service Broker. Для каждой строки в этом представлении имеется соответствующая строка с одинаковыми endpoint_id в представлении sys.tcp_endpoints, содержащего метаданные конфигурации TCP. TCP — единственный разрешенный протокол для компонента Service Broker.

Имя столбца Тип данных Description
<наследуемые столбцы> -- Наследует столбцы из sys.endpoints (Transact-SQL).
is_message_forwarding_enabled bit Осуществляет пересылку сообщений поддержки конечных точек. Изначально это значение равно 0 (отключено). Не допускает значения NULL.
message_forwarding_size int Максимальное количество мегабайт пространства tempdb , которое разрешено использовать для пересылки сообщений. Изначально это значение равно 10. Не допускает значения NULL.
connection_auth tinyint Тип проверки подлинности соединения, требуемый при подключении к этой конечной точке, один из следующих.

1 — NTLM

2 — KERBEROS

3 . СОГЛАСОВАНИЕ

4 — СЕРТИФИКАТ

5 — NTLM, CERTIFICATE

6 — KERBEROS, СЕРТИФИКАТ

7 . СОГЛАСОВАНИЕ, СЕРТИФИКАТ

8 — CERTIFICATE, NTLM

9 . СЕРТИФИКАТ, KERBEROS

10 — СЕРТИФИКАТ, СОГЛАСОВАНИЕ

Не допускает значения NULL.
connection_auth_desc nvarchar(60) Описание типа проверки подлинности, необходимого для соединения с данной конечной точкой, одно из следующих:

NTLM

KERBEROS

NEGOTIATE

СЕРТИФИКАТ

NTLM, CERTIFICATE

KERBEROS, CERTIFICATE

NEGOTIATE, CERTIFICATE

CERTIFICATE, NTLM

CERTIFICATE, KERBEROS

CERTIFICATE, NEGOTIATE

Допускает значение NULL.
certificate_id int Идентификатор сертификата, используемого для проверки подлинности (если таковой имеется).

0 = используется проверка подлинности Windows.
encryption_algorithm tinyint Алгоритм шифрования. Ниже приведены возможные значения с их описанием и соответствующими параметрами DDL.

0 : НЕТ. Соответствующий параметр DDL: отключен.

1 : RC4. Соответствующий параметр DDL: {Обязательный | Обязательный алгоритм RC4}.

2 : AES. Соответствующий параметр DDL: обязательный алгоритм AES.

3 : NONE, RC4. Соответствующий параметр DDL: {Поддерживается | Поддерживаемый алгоритм RC4}.

4 : NONE, AES. Соответствующий параметр DDL: поддерживаемый алгоритм AES.

5 : RC4, AES. Соответствующий параметр DDL: обязательный алгоритм RC4 AES.

6 : AES, RC4. Соответствующий параметр DDL: обязательный алгоритм AES RC4.

7 : NONE, RC4, AES. Соответствующий параметр DDL: поддерживаемый алгоритм RC4 AES.

8 : NONE, AES, RC4. Соответствующий параметр DDL: поддерживаемый алгоритм AES RC4.

Не допускает значения NULL.
encryption_algorithm_desc nvarchar(60) Описание алгоритма шифрования. Возможные значения и соответствующие параметры DDL перечислены ниже.

NONE: отключен

RC4: {Обязательный | Обязательный алгоритм RC4}

AES: обязательный алгоритм AES

NONE, RC4: {Поддерживается | Поддерживаемый алгоритм RC4}

NONE, AES: поддерживаемый алгоритм AES

RC4, AES: обязательный алгоритм RC4 AES

AES, RC4 : обязательный алгоритм AES RC4

NONE, RC4, AES: поддерживаемый алгоритм RC4 AES

NONE, AES, RC4: поддерживаемый алгоритм AES RC4

Допускает значение NULL.

Замечания

Примечание.

Алгоритм RC4 поддерживается только в целях обратной совместимости. Когда база данных имеет уровень совместимости 90 или 100, новые материалы могут шифроваться только с помощью алгоритмов RC4 или RC4_128. (Не рекомендуется.) Используйте вместо этого более новые алгоритмы, например AES. В SQL Server 2012 (11.x) и более поздних версиях материалы, зашифрованные с помощью RC4 или RC4_128, можно расшифровать на любом уровне совместимости.

Разрешения

Видимость метаданных в представлениях каталога ограничена защищаемыми объектами, которыми владеет пользователь или которым пользователь получил некоторое разрешение. Дополнительные сведения см. в разделе Metadata Visibility Configuration.

См. также

ALTER ENDPOINT (Transact-SQL)
CREATE ENDPOINT (Transact-SQL)